More Megapixels and Extensive Creative Controls

The S23 Ultra offers Samsung Galaxy’s most advanced camera system yet. It is tailored for nearly any lighting conditions and engineered to render incredible detail. Improved Nightography capabilities transform how the Galaxy S series optimizes photos and videos in a wide range of ambient conditions. Users will be able to get sharper images and videos, whether filming your favorite song in a concert, snapping a selfie at the aquarium, or even grabbing a group shot of friends at dinner. Visual noise that usually ruins low-light images is corrected by a new AI-powered image signal processing (ISP) algorithm that enhances object details and color tone.

A new 200MP Adaptive Pixel sensor is also featured on the S23 Ultra. It uses pixel binning to support multiple levels of high-resolution processing at once. And the series also introduces fast autofocus and their first Super HDR selfie camera, jumping from 30fps to 60fps. This results in a noticeably better front-facing images and videos.

Premium Performance for Mobile Gaming

Samsung and Qualcomm has optimized the Samsung Galaxy experience with the brand new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 Mobile Platform for Galaxy. It’s the most powerful and efficient platform ever in a Samsung Galaxy smartphone, as well as the fastest Snapdragon available today. Meanwhile, the S23 Ultra also feature a 5000mAh battery that powers a larger camera than the S22 Ultra.

A newly designed CPU micro architecture boosts the processing abilities of the new Galaxy S23 Series by about 30% compared to the Galaxy S22 Series. Its highly efficient NPU architecture has been optimized by 49% to balance performance and power while using an AI algorithm to help users take epic photos and videos. Another improvement to the series is the optimized GPU, which is approximately 41% faster compared to the previous series, and is designed especially for power users.

The S23 Ultra also comes ready to support real-time ray tracing as it comes to the mobile gaming mainstream. Users will be able to see noticeably more lifelike renderings of scenes, thanks to technology that simulates and tracks every ray of light. Plus, Samsung Galaxy’s now bigger vapor chamber keeps your gaming marathon going.

S23 Ultra Gaming

To maximize the mobile gaming experience, the S23 Ultra sports an expansive 6.8-inch edge display with a reduced curvature to create a larger and flatter surface area. Its unique Enhanced comfort feature allows users to adjust color tones and contrast levels, which lessens eye strain from screen time at night. Vision booster now adjusts at three levels of lighting instead of two in order to combat brightness and glare in daylight.

Designed with the Planet in Mind

Samsung Galaxy Sustainability

Since the Galaxy S22 Series, Samsung Galaxy has increased its use of recycled materials. The Galaxy S23 Series now has a wider variety of recycled materials than any other Galaxy smartphone. This includes pre-consumer recycled aluminum and glass and post-consumer recycled plastics sourced from discarded fishing nets, PET bottles, and water barrels. The new series is also the first to market Corning Gorilla Glass Victus 2, which offers durability for long-term use. It also consists of an average of 22% pre-consumer recycled content. Plus, every S23 Series device comes in a redesigned packaging box which applied paper made with 100% recycled paper. The new series is also UL ECOLOGO certified. This means the product has been certified for reduced environmental impact.

For users who want to extend the life of their device, The Galaxy S3 Series’ premium experience can be sustained through the years with 4 generations of OS upgrades and 5 years of security updates. To enhance its longevity, users can also leverage programs such as Samsung Care, a support service for accidental damages, repair, and more.

User-Friendly Security and Privacy

Every Samsung smartphone comes with their end-to-end Samsung Knox protection. It has received more government and industry certifications than any other mobile device, platform, or solution on the market. Its Security and Privacy Dashboard gives users full visibility over who has access to their data and how it’s being used. With just a glance, it’s easy to see if personal data is at risk and receive simple prompts to change settings for a more secure experience. Users can also decide exactly which apps and programs get access to their data and how it can be used. For an added layer of security, Knox Vault protects critical information by isolating it from the rest of the device. This includes the OS, for added protection against vulnerabilities.

Price and Availability

Samsung Galaxy S23 Series

The Samsung Galaxy S23 Series comes in 4 nature-inspired matte hues: Phantom Black, Cream, Green, and Lavender. The Galaxy S23 will retail for PHP 53,990 for the 128GB variant, and PHP 57,990 for the 256GB variant. Meanwhile, the Galaxy S23+ will retail for PHP 68,990 for the 256GB variant, and PHP 76,990 for the 512GB variant. Lastly, the Galaxy S23 Ultra will retail for PHP 81,990 for the 256GB variant, and PHP 89,990 for the 512GB variant. A Samsung.com-exclusive 1TB variant of the Galaxy S23 Ultra is also available at PHP 103,990.
